The Relationship Between Life Events And Mental Health:Moderated Serial Mediating Effect

University stage has a far-reaching influence on life.However,with the increasing pressure of study and employment,more and more college students have begun to develop various forms of mental health problems,which will seriously hinder the development of college students.Psychology has a long-standing concern for the mental health of college students.Related research reveals that various life events faced by college students in their daily lives are one of the important reasons that affect the psychological health of college students.As a kind of stressor,life events can not only directly affect mental health,but also indirectly affect the individual's mental health through other variables.And previous studies have shown that sleep quality,internet addiction may play an important role between these two factors.In order to explore more deeply and comprehensively the impact and the corresponding mechanisms of life events on the mental health of college students,and to examine the potential mediation among them,this study introduced mediating variables such as sleep quality and internet addiction while examining the influence of life events on mental health,and constructed a serial mediating model about these four variables.On the other hand,in order to explore possible boundary conditions and individual differences,this study also examined the modulating effect of orientations to happiness on the relationship between sleep quality and internet addiction.This study used the General Health Questionnaire,Adolescent Self-Rating Life Events Checklist,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index,Chinese Internet Addiction Scale(revision)and Orientations to Happiness Scale to conduct questionnaire surveys.A total of 537 undergraduates and postgraduates from different schools and majors were selected as subjects,then SPSS and AMOS software were used to analyze the data.The results are as follows:(1)In terms of mental health,the degree of depression of male students is significantly higher than that of female students.In terms of life events,the degree of influence of interpersonal relationship among sophomore and junior students is significantly higher than that of the second and third graduate student.In terms of sleep quality,male students used sleep medicine more than female students;freshman students had significantly more daytime dysfunction than sophomores,juniors,and seniors.Compared with male students,female students have more compulsive use of internet and withdrawal symptoms of internet addiction,and more tolerance symptoms of internet addiction.Female college students have a significantly higher hedonic orientation than male students;college students from cities have significantly higher hedonic orientation than college students from rural areas.(2)The results of correlation analysis show that there are significant positive correlations between the four variables of life events,mental health,sleep quality and internet addiction.(3)Structural equation modeling and subsequent mediation analysis show that life events can not directly predict mental health.Life events positively predict the quality of sleep,sleep quality positively predict mental health,sleep quality plays a complete intermediary role between life events and mental health.Life events positively predict internet addiction,internet addiction positively predicts mental health,internet addiction plays a complete intermediary role between life events and mental health.Sleep quality positively predicts internet addiction,sleep quality and internet addiction play a chain intermediary role between life events and mental health.(4)The modulating effect of eudaimonic orientation on the relationship between sleep quality and internet addiction is not significant,while hedonic orientation can positively moderate the effects of sleep quality to internet addiction.The results of this study show that life events can indirectly impair the mental health of college students by reducing the quality of sleep and increasing internet addiction.At the same time,compared with college students who have a low hedonic orientation,college students with high hedonic orientation tend to be more likely to develop into internet addiction under the influence of poor sleep,and finally impair the mental health.Therefore,in order to maintain physical and mental health in the face of the pressures and challenges of life,college students should pay attention to adjusting their sleep,learn to control their online behavior,and avoid being addicted to the short pleasure brought by the internet.
